Smashbook Cover

I promised myself at the beginning of this year to journal everyday this year. As I started I found out about smashbooking. Basically, you stick and tape anything mementous inside your smashbook. 

Here is my second smashbook of this year. It gets bulkier as you go along. 
My smashbook was originally a blank composition book. 


To make the pages thicker, I washi taped two pages together. Not only does it make the pages thicker but adds a variety of color. 

Here is the cover: 
I added some quotes and random designs on card stock paper to make the cover more durable. 



To make the quotes I took regular Crayola washable markers and drew random stripes. 



Then taking a Sakura white gel pen I wrote in my quote. I highly recommend Sakura gel pens due to the ink's thickness. 



Then I tipped the quote around the edges and took a marker to give the fluffy edges color. 


I picked the place on my cover and got my Mod Podge and painted it on to the journal. 



Mod Podge is one of my must have smashbooking tools. Not only is it good for firming up the cover, but it's an easy stick on to pages. It also provides a glossy and preserving look.

First I penciled Cinderella's outline. 
I used acrylic paints, but in a watercolor fashion to get the different shades of blue without mixing paints. 


To get the flesh tone I mixed white with a drop of red, then a drop of yellow, the lastly a tiny drop of green. The more darker you add red the more light add yellow. 

I could have done a better job with her hair, but I wanted to keep it dirty blond. 


Using my liner brush I painted the quote. 


I was really scared to mess up her face. But I used a .05 Graphik Liner pen to draw in her eyes and eyebrows.
